How much does house painting cost in College Park, MD?
Interior painting in College Park averages $2–$6 per square foot, while exterior painting runs $1,500–$5,000 for an average home. Prices vary by prep work needed, paint quality, and accessibility. Compare quotes from verified College Park painters on SAORR.
When is the best time to paint the exterior of my College Park home?
The ideal time for exterior painting in the College Park area is late spring through early fall when temperatures are consistently above 50°F. Avoid painting during the humidity of mid-summer or when rain is forecast. Most College Park painters book up fast in peak season, so plan ahead.
How often should I repaint my home in College Park?
In the College Park area’s climate, exterior paint typically lasts 5–7 years. Harsh winters, UV exposure, and moisture accelerate wear. Interior paint lasts 7–10 years in high-traffic areas. Regular touch-ups between full repaints keep your College Park home looking sharp.
